Robotic pellet extrusion breaks the limits of traditional 3D printers.


With an open robotic motion platform and high-flow pellet extrusion, it enables unlimited build dimensions, ultra-fast deposition, and low-cost material usage.


This technology is ideal for full-scale prototypes, molds, tooling, furniture, displays, and large structural parts — delivering productivity and material savings at a scale no gantry printer can match.


DML World provides configuration guidance, material sourcing, and application consulting for businesses adopting pellet-based robotic printing.

This system is best suited for low- and medium-temperature materials such as PLA, PETG, PP, and PA.
